Louisiana Race Showcases ConfusionNational Catholic Register Dec. 8-14, 2002by JOSHUA MERCERRegister CorrespondentABITA SPRINGS, La. - Although retired at age 70, Ed Jeanfreau is working harder than ever before. He was working to educate Catholics about the very different positions held by Louisiana's pro-abortion incumbent, Democrat Sen. Mary Landrieu, and her pro-life Republican challenger, Suzie Terrell.
